Alert: log-sampling ratio on the Chattermill ingest service dropped below 1:500. This means security-relevant events may be discarded before reaching the Vaultline audit sink. Triggered when the sampler sheds load for more than five minutes. Verify sampler config was not modified, then check ingest backpressure. Do not silence without review. Sampling policy and approved ratios are documented on the page below.

operations page: https://jenkins.zemvarcloud.local/job/merge_requests/repo/build/73930b4b30f0a8ed

TURN-208: Gatevale turnstile counters at the Merrow Field pilot double-count when a rotation reverses mid-cycle. Attendance totals drift roughly 2% high per event. The debounce window fix is implemented, reviewed by Ilsa, and soak-tested across two simulated match days without drift. Ready for your cut; the candidate build is identified below.

trace token, tagag-tafog: htk6_5ed18c

Alert: SDK Parity Drift — Kestrelpay Clients. Our automated parity checker has flagged that the Kestrelpay Swift SDK (v4.2) now exposes the deferred-capture flow, while the Kotlin SDK (v4.1) does not. Customers integrating both platforms may report inconsistent behavior at checkout. Please tag related tickets with "parity-drift" and avoid promising a release date, as the Kotlin update is still in review. For questions or to flag affected accounts, reach out here.

escalation mailbox, bafog-fafog: ulador@paliqlabs.internal

Meeting notes, 14th sync — Calendar sync conflict in the Plumline plugin API. When an external plugin writes an event while HostSync is mid-reconciliation, duplicate entries appear on the Tidewell calendar backend. Agreed: plugins must honor the new sync-lock header starting next release; we will publish a migration guide and a two-week grace period. Plugin authors should test against the staging tenant before the cutover. Questions on conflict semantics should be directed to the engineer responsible, named below.

signatory, yagap-bawig: Ulaath Eliath